Introduction

The Cummins 3101978 Heat Shield is a component designed for use in commercial trucks. Its primary role is to manage the distribution of heat within the truck’s exhaust system, thereby protecting adjacent components from excessive heat exposure. This Cummins part is integral to maintaining the operational efficiency and safety of the vehicle 1.

Purpose and Function

The heat shield in a truck’s exhaust system serves to regulate heat distribution. By redirecting and dissipating heat away from sensitive components, it helps maintain optimal operating temperatures. This function is vital for preventing heat-related damage to nearby parts, ensuring the longevity and reliability of the exhaust system 2.

Role of Part 3101978 Heat Shield in Engine Systems

The 3101978 Heat Shield is instrumental in maintaining the thermal integrity of various engine components, particularly when integrated with the valve cover.

Integration with Valve Cover

When the 3101978 Heat Shield is installed adjacent to the valve cover, it effectively reduces the heat transfer to this component. The valve cover, which encloses the valve train, is susceptible to elevated temperatures due to its proximity to the combustion chamber. By placing the heat shield between the valve cover and potential heat sources, such as the exhaust manifold or turbocharger, the shield helps in dissipating heat away from the valve cover. This ensures that the valve cover maintains an optimal operating temperature, thereby preserving the integrity of the lubricants and the mechanical components housed within 10.

Enhanced Engine Performance

The reduction in heat transfer to the valve cover also contributes to more stable engine performance. Excessive heat can lead to thermal expansion of the valve cover, potentially causing gasket failure or warping. The heat shield mitigates these risks by providing a barrier that redirects heat, thus promoting a more consistent engine environment 11.

Protection of Adjacent Components

Beyond the valve cover, the 3101978 Heat Shield plays a role in protecting other nearby components. For instance, wiring harnesses and sensor units located near the valve cover can be sensitive to high temperatures. The heat shield acts as a protective layer, ensuring these components operate within their specified temperature ranges, thereby enhancing the overall reliability and longevity of the engine system 12.
